Household bed net ownership and use among under-5 children in Nigeria

Bed net ownership is low in Nigeria, and free distribution does not guarantee usage. Targeted education is crucial for consistent use among children under 5 to reduce malaria parasitemia.

Area of Science:

  • Public Health
  • Epidemiology
  • Malariology

Background:

  • Malaria is a leading cause of death in sub-Saharan Africa, disproportionately affecting children under 5.
  • Insecticide-treated bed nets (ITNs) are a cost-effective malaria prevention strategy recommended by the WHO.
  • Despite distribution initiatives, ITN uptake and usage remain low in many Nigerian households.

Purpose of the Study:

  • To investigate household characteristics and child factors influencing bed net ownership and use among Nigerian children under 5.
  • To determine the effect of bed net usage on malaria parasitemia in this vulnerable age group.

Main Methods:

  • Utilized data from a nationally representative sample of 5895 households in Nigeria (2010 Demographic and Health Survey).
  • Employed statistical analyses to identify determinants of bed net ownership and usage.
  • Examined the association between bed net use and malaria prevalence in children under 5.

Main Results:

  • Only 45.5% of households owned a bed net, with 48.5% of children under 5 using one.
  • Free acquisition increased ownership but not usage.
  • Ownership and usage were higher in rural, poorer households, and those with more young children or bed nets.
  • Malaria parasitemia was significantly higher in households without bed nets, among children not using them, and in poorer, rural households.

Conclusions:

  • Bed net ownership in Nigeria is insufficient and does not automatically translate to consistent usage.
  • Effective malaria control requires more than free distribution; it necessitates sustained household education on correct and consistent ITN use.
  • Interventions should prioritize vulnerable populations, including children under 5 and pregnant women, to combat malaria effectively.
